CCS(Code Composer Studio)使用的 主要是C和C++编程语言。它是一款由德州仪器(Texas Instruments)开发的集成开发环境(IDE),主要用于嵌入式系统的软件开发和调试。CCS支持多种处理器架构,包括ARM、MSP430、C2000等,并集成了GNU工具链和TI工具链,以支持C和C++编写的程序的编译和调试。
除了C和C++,CCS还支持汇编语言,适用于对性能要求较高或需要底层控制的操作。此外,CCS还可以与MATLAB和Simulink等工具结合使用,以便进行系统级建模和仿真。
总结来说,CCS主要使用的编程语言包括:
C语言:
由于其高效性、灵活性和可移植性,C语言是嵌入式系统开发中最常用的编程语言之一。
C++语言:
作为C语言的扩展,C++支持面向对象编程,使得嵌入式软件开发更加方便。
汇编语言:
用于编写底层代码或与硬件直接交互。
MATLAB和Simulink:
用于系统级建模和仿真。